We are looking for a creative and motivated Graphic Designer to join our in-house marketing team in Swindon. This is an exciting opportunity for someone who loves design but also wants to get involved in wider marketing activities from product launches and international campaigns to events and social media promotions.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Create and develop designs for digital and print, including brochures, flyers, adverts, packaging, exhibition stands, and web content.
  • Work on social media campaigns, creating visuals and short animations to support brand and product promotions.
  • Assist with event and exhibition materials, including signage, banners, and on-site branding.
  • Collaborate with the marketing team to develop global campaigns and product launch assets.
  • Maintain brand consistency across all communications, ensuring alignment with BGA’s visual identity.
  • Support in-house photography, video editing, and creative content production when required.
  • Contribute creative ideas to enhance engagement and brand recognition.

Skills:

  • Fully proficient in Adobe Creative Suite (Illustrator, Photoshop, InDesign; Premiere Pro or After Effects is a bonus).
  • Strong creative and conceptual design skills with great attention to detail.
  • A proactive, can-do attitude and willingness to get involved in a variety of projects.
  • Excellent time management and ability to handle multiple projects at once.
  • A passion for design and interest in the automotive or manufacturing industry is a plus.

How to prepare for a job interview at BG Automotive

✨Showcase Your Portfolio

Make sure to bring a well-organised portfolio that highlights your best work. Tailor it to include projects relevant to the job description, like digital and print designs, social media visuals, and any creative campaigns you've worked on.

✨Know the Brand Inside Out

Before the interview, research the company’s brand identity and recent marketing campaigns. Understanding their visual style and messaging will help you discuss how you can contribute to maintaining brand consistency and enhancing engagement.

✨Prepare for Creative Challenges

Be ready to discuss your design process and how you tackle creative challenges. Think of examples where you’ve had to collaborate with a team or adapt your designs based on feedback, as this shows your proactive attitude and teamwork skills.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ions about the role and the marketing team’s goals. Inquire about upcoming projects or campaigns, which demonstrates your enthusiasm for getting involved and your interest in contributing creatively to their success.
